  2. I am just about to send my evidence for the 751 and I just want to run by you all my evidence. I think I have enough but let me know your thoughts..thanks for some feedback!!!

    also, did people give one check for 625 or two seperate checks, one for filing and one fore biometrics

    check for 625

    Copy of the passport and green card Copy of our joint tax return for 2005 and 2006

    Copy of tax transcripts for 2005 and 2006

    Bank Statements of our Joint savings account from Bank of America

    Proof of my husband as the beneficiary for my life insurance policy.

    Copies of our Liberty Mutual car insurance notices with both of our names as drivers under the same plan.

    Copies of two leases showing joint residence at two apartments (one in 2006, one in 2007).

    Copy of three Comcast cable bill with both of our names.

    Copy of a PG &E Electric Bill in both of our names.

    Copy of our Costco cards on a joint account.

    A copy of three airline reservations for a vacations to New Jersey, Honduras and Arizona.

    Pictures showing trips we have taken together over past two years.

    Letter from my employer stating Dental insurance under same plan.

    Copy of Dental Statement with both of our names

    Copy of 3 Sprint cell phone bills stating us on the same family plan.

    Copies of Cards and various mail others showing same place of residence.

    Six original letters written and notarized by U.S. citizen friends, attesting to our relationship and marriage.
